bustersobe Posted October 1 Report Share Posted October 1 In March of 2002 my partner David Mardini and I came up with an idea for a television project.....a channel featuring the progressive lifestyle and music of club and DJ culture specifically programmed to be watched late night. We cobbled together about $1000 between the two of us and used our knowledge of the local market to PRE-SELL the project with advertisers. By September of 2002, A3 (Alternative TV) hit the airwaves of MIAMI BEACH to about 100,000 households. Reaction was so positive that within 4 months the project had the opportunity to be broadcast on the mainland, and a fully realized progressive lifestyle channel was born.
